Corporal Andrew Forest Chris, 25 was from Huntsville Alabama, a son of Cheryl and the late Thomas Anthony Chris. Joined the US Army out of high school. Andrew was a proud member of Company B, 3rd Battalion, 75th Ranger Regiment Fort Benning Georgia. On last visit home he visited his father's grave- put his Ranger patch and ribbons on the grave site and said "This is for You!" Cpl. Chris was KIA when a car bomb exploded in Iraq. Posthumous medals include the Purple Heart, Bronze Star with "V" (Valor)devise, Meritorious Service Medal. Son, Friend, Proud US Army Ranger who gave hi life in Operation Iraqi Freedom.
